Palliative Care
Care designed to give the patient as pain-free a condition as possible. In addition to physical needs, the patient’s social, psychological, cultural, and spiritual needs are considered.

Hospice Movement
A care approach that focuses on the palliation of a terminally ill patient's symptoms, addressing physical, emotional, spiritual, and social needs.
